Garden River First Nation and Atikameksheng Anishnawbek wish to provide another perspective to the article, “Justice Myers finds $510 million payout ‘was not the deal’” by Professor Catherine Murton Stoehr, published in Anishinabek News on November 6, 2025, and reaffirm the purpose and principles that guided our actions in seeking judicial review of the Robinson Huron Treaty Litigation Fund (RHTLF)’s legal fees.
Our decision to challenge the $510 million legal fee was not a challenge to ceremony, culture, or the lawyers who represented us. It was a stand for accountability and fairness, the principles that lie at the heart of both Anishinaabe and Canadian law and the two worlds we live in.
